About Mash Gallery

Founded in 2018, MASH Gallery is a contemporary art gallery originally located in the Arts District, Downtown LA. In 2022, the gallery moved to West Hollywood, in the center of the design district. MASH Gallery was founded by Haleh Mashian, a contemporary painter, curator, musician, and fashion designer. MASH Gallery focuses on thematic exhibitions and showcasing many local and international artists both emerging and established. "Pool Fun" - Colorful Figurative Painting by Ghanaian Artist Philip Letsu, 2022
Located in West Hollywood, CA
This large vertical painting measures 60 inches high and 48 inches wide. The sides are a continuation of the dyed linen. This artwork is stretched and ready to hang. Philip Letsu is a Ghanaian artist currently living and working in Ho, Ghana. Komla’s practice is driven by the significant need to document urban lifestyles and culture. Focusing on the power memories and imagination in relation to representation and identity formation, Philip creates paintings that confronts issues surrounding representation with the intention to document that which is neglected. In his words, Letsu expresses, “My greatest inspiration is the innermost satisfaction derived after a quiet time, when I take some time off to explore positive energies found within to make paintings that feed the visual need and breed the admiration from people." Philip Letsu studied in the prestigious Ghanatta College of Arts and design in Ghana in 2016 - the same school that has produced many significant artists like Amoako Boafo...
